Analysis

Auvergne recorded 6.4% for unemployment rates by citizenship and nuts 2 region in 2025.

That represents a change of down 17.9% on the previous year and down 25.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, unemployment rates by citizenship and nuts 2 region in Auvergne peaked at 10.6% in 1999 and was at its lowest, 5.5%, in 2020.

That places Auvergne 168th out of 436 regions with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 26 years of available data.

Unemployment rates by citizenship and NUTS 2 region in Auvergne, year by year

Annual values for Unemployment rates by citizenship and NUTS 2 region in Auvergne, 1999 to 2025.
Year Percentage Change
1999 10.6%
2000 10.2% -3.8%
2001 7.5% -26.5%
2002 6.9% -8.0%
2004 8.1% +17.4%
2005 7.1% -12.3%
2006 7.3% +2.8%
2007 8.3% +13.7%
2008 6.4% -22.9%
2009 7.4% +15.6%
2010 7.1% -4.1%
2011 8.4% +18.3%
2012 10.1% +20.2%
2013 8.9% -11.9%
2014 7.3% -18.0%
2015 8.6% +17.8%
2016 7.2% -16.3%
2017 8.4% +16.7%
2018 7.8% -7.1%
2019 5.6% -28.2%
2020 5.5% -1.8%
2021 7.0% +27.3%
2022 7.1% +1.4%
2023 7.1% +0.0%
2024 7.8% +9.9%
2025 6.4% -17.9%
